Founded in 1909, the NAACP is the oldest and largest civil rights organization.  From the ballot box to the classroom, the thousands of dedicated workers, organizers, leaders and members who make up the NAACP continue to fight for social justice for all Americans.

Our Mission

NAACP - MISSION STATEMENT

The mission of the National Association for the Advancement of Colored People is to ensure the political, educational, social and economic equality of rights of all persons to eliminate racial hatred and racial discrimination.

 

 

Our Vision

The vision of the National Association for the Advancement of Colored People is to ensure a society in which all individuals have equal rights and there is no racial hatred or racial discrimination.
